Dr Michael Pelly

Known for his vast diagnostic insight, Dr Michael Pelly is one of London’s most trusted physicians. A Consultant Physician at Chelsea and Westminster Hospital for over 35 years and Senior Lecturer at Imperial College School of Medicine, he specialises in complex general medicine, cardiovascular and cerebrovascular risk, post-viral fatigue and travel-related disease. His humanitarian work has taken him across the world, from managing epidemics to caring for displaced communities, experience that brings a rare global perspective to his practice. The doctor other doctors call for their own families, his consultations at King Edward VII’s and The Cromwell Hospital are marked by careful listening and clear, confident guidance.

Dr Paul Glynne

A leading figure in General Internal Medicine, Dr Paul Glynne is the doctor specialists turn to when a diagnosis proves elusive. With over 30 years’ experience, he is known for unravelling complex medical puzzles. He has particular expertise in long COVID and other post-viral syndromes, having co-authored one of the first studies identifying their underlying immune abnormalities. As the founder of The Physicians’ Clinic on Harley Street, he's pioneered a collaborative model of private practice that unites top consultants under one roof, delivering seamless, world-class care for even the most challenging conditions.

Disclaimer: This compendium has been developed by compiling a list of 45 highly-respected private GPs across central and Greater London and then approaching them for recommendations. Our results were based on detailed analysis of the collective insights and popular opinions of those who responded. Some of the specialists on our list had declined to be featured due to imminent retirement or limited capacity. Our team looked into the names that were repeatedly recommended by these GPs and identified the leading specialists based on popularity. While every effort has been made to ensure the recommendations are well-informed and reflect genuine professional experience, the list is not an official ranking or guarantee of clinical outcomes. It is intended as a helpful guide rather than medical advice, and patients should conduct their own research and consult with healthcare professionals when making decisions about specialist care.
